メンバーメニュー

ようこそ、ゲストさん

トップ > カテゴリ一覧 > フリー/フリー 容量増加/フリー PHP+MySQLプラン > 500 Internal Server Errorによりサイト表示不可

質問

  • フリー PHP+MySQL

    500 Internal Server Errorによりサイト表示不可
  • 本文:

    WordPressで作ったサイトが遅かったので、以下サイトを参考にサイトの高速化を行いました。
    https://yoko51.com/cocoon-speedup/
    「Cocoon設定」から「高速化」>7箇所にチェック

    上記をしてから、サイトが表示されなくなってしまいました。
    ページには以下の文字が記載されています。(▼より下参照)
    スターサーバーのQ&Aにも似た質問があり、「ログファイルを確認してください」とありましたが、管理画面のどこにもログデータが落とせるボタンがありませんでした。(フリープランだからでしょうか)
    どうすればサイトが表示される様になるのか、お手数ですがご教示いただけますと幸いです。よろしくお願いいたします。

    ▼サイトに表示されている文字
    500 Internal Server Error
    アクセスしようとしたページは
    表示できませんでした。
    CGIやPHPなど内部参照におけるエラーの為、
    目的のページが表示できなかったことを意味します。

    以下のような原因が考えられます。
    断続的に発生する場合:
    CGIの負荷が大きい(CGIプロセスが多数動作している)。
    常に発生する場合:
    CGIのパーミッション設定に誤りがある。 / CGIのソースコードに問題がある。/ .htaccess の記述に誤りがある。


  • 緊急度:急ぎ投稿者:ハッサクさん投稿時間:2022/05/09 20:04
質問に対する回答は締め切られました

回答 No.11788

  • この回答がベストアンサーです

  • 本文:



    おそらく「ブラウザキャッシュの有効化」で、 .htaccess を書き換えてると思います。

    https://wp-cocoon.com/community/cocoon-theme/%E9%AB%98%E9%80%9F%E5%8C%96%E3%81%AB%E3%81%A4%E3%81%84%E3%81%A6/#post-1110




    .htaccessで追記された分を削除すれば、たぶん、もとに戻ると思う。



    >「ログファイルを確認してください」とありましたが、管理画面のどこにもログデータが落とせるボタンがありませんでした。(フリープランだからでしょうか)

    https://www.star.ne.jp/free/functions.php

    フリープランにはその機能はありません。




  • 投稿者:k-tanさん 投稿時間:2022/05/09 23:16

回答 No.11791

  • 本文:

    この度はご回答くださり、誠にありがとうございます。
    結論を言うと、サイトが無事表示されました。本当にありがとうございました!

    ファイルマネージャーの中には、以下2つがあり、どちらか悩み前者の内容を変更しました。
    .htaccess
    .htaccess.cocoon

    行った対応としては、以下テキストを削除しました。
    相変わらずサイトは重いままのため、以下を挿入せず、他にサイトの動きを速める方法があれば、ご教示いただけますと幸いです。
    なんでも聞いてしまい、申し訳ございません。

    # ETags(Configure entity tags) を無視する設定
    <ifModule mod_headers.c>
    Header unset ETag
    </ifModule>
    FileETag None

    # Enable Keep-Alive を設定
    <IfModule mod_headers.c>
    Header set Connection keep-alive
    </IfModule>

    # MIME Type 追加
    <IfModule mime_module>
    AddType text/cache-manifest .appcache
    AddType image/x-icon .ico
    AddType image/svg+xml .svg
    AddType application/x-font-ttf .ttf
    AddType application/x-font-woff .woff
    AddType application/x-font-woff2 .woff2
    AddType application/x-font-opentype .otf
    AddType application/vnd.ms-fontobject .eot
    </IfModule>

    # プロクシキャッシュの設定(画像とフォントをキャッシュ)
    <IfModule mod_headers.c>
    <FilesMatch "\.(ico|jpe?g|png|gif|svg|swf|pdf|ttf|woff|woff2|otf|eot)$">
    Header set Cache-Control "max-age=604800, public"
    </FilesMatch>
    # プロキシサーバーが間違ったコンテンツを配布しないようにする
    Header append Vary Accept-Encoding env=!dont-vary
    </IfModule>

    # ブラウザキャッシュの設定
    <IfModule mod_headers.c>
    <ifModule mod_expires.c>
    ExpiresActive On

    # キャッシュ初期化(1秒に設定)
    ExpiresDefault "access plus 1 seconds"

    # MIME Type ごとの設定
    ExpiresByType text/css "access plus 1 weeks"
    ExpiresByType text/js "access plus 1 weeks"
    ExpiresByType text/javascript "access plus 1 weeks"
    ExpiresByType image/gif "access plus 1 weeks"
    ExpiresByType image/jpeg "access plus 1 weeks"
    ExpiresByType image/png "access plus 1 weeks"
    ExpiresByType image/svg+xml "access plus 1 year"
    ExpiresByType application/pdf "access plus 1 weeks"
    ExpiresByType application/javascript "access plus 1 weeks"
    ExpiresByType application/x-javascript "access plus 1 weeks"
    ExpiresByType application/x-shockwave-flash "access plus 1 weeks"
    ExpiresByType application/x-font-ttf "access plus 1 year"
    ExpiresByType application/x-font-woff "access plus 1 year"
    ExpiresByType application/x-font-woff2 "access plus 1 year"
    ExpiresByType application/x-font-opentype "access plus 1 year"
    ExpiresByType application/vnd.ms-fontobject "access plus 1 year"
    </IfModule>
    </IfModule>

    # Gzip圧縮の設定
    <IfModule mod_deflate.c>
    SetOutputFilter DEFLATE

    # 古いブラウザでは無効
    BrowserMatch ^Mozilla/4\.0[678] no-gzip
    BrowserMatch ^Mozilla/4 gzip-only-text/html
    BrowserMatch \bMSIE\s(7|8) !no-gzip !gzip-only-text/html

    # 画像など圧縮済みのコンテンツは再圧縮しない
    SetEnvIfNoCase Request_URI \.(?:gif|jpe?g|png|ico|eot|woff|woff2)$ no-gzip dont-vary

    AddOutputFilterByType DEFLATE text/plain
    AddOutputFilterByType DEFLATE text/html
    AddOutputFilterByType DEFLATE text/xml
    AddOutputFilterByType DEFLATE text/css
    AddOutputFilterByType DEFLATE text/js
    AddOutputFilterByType DEFLATE image/svg+xml
    AddOutputFilterByType DEFLATE application/xml
    AddOutputFilterByType DEFLATE application/xhtml+xml
    AddOutputFilterByType DEFLATE application/rss+xml
    AddOutputFilterByType DEFLATE application/atom_xml
    AddOutputFilterByType DEFLATE application/javascript
    AddOutputFilterByType DEFLATE application/x-javascript
    AddOutputFilterByType DEFLATE application/x-httpd-php
    AddOutputFilterByType DEFLATE application/x-font-ttf
    AddOutputFilterByType DEFLATE application/x-font-opentype
    </IfModule>



  • 投稿者:ハッサクさん 投稿時間:2022/05/11 21:02

回答 No.11824

  • 本文:

    平素はネットオウルをご利用いただき誠にありがとうございます。
    ネットオウル運営チームです。

    本ご質問は一定期間新たな回答がなかったため
    運営チームで締め切らせていただきました。


    ■質問の締め切りについて

    Q&A掲示板はユーザー様同士の交流掲示板です。
    回答がもらえた場合、回答者へお礼コメントをしましょう。

    問題が解決した際にはベストアンサーを選び、
    質問を締め切ってください。


    ■再度のご質問について

    ご質問が未解決の場合、「ワンポイント!」を参考に、
    再度質問してみてください。

    【ワンポイント!】

     メールやFTPの設定がうまくいかない場合、
     ネットオウルIDやサーバーIDなどのお客様情報を公開しない範囲で、
     現在の設定内容を出来るだけ詳しく書いてみましょう。
     設定内容のミスを指摘してもらえるかもしれません。

     エラーが出てうまくいかない場合、
     エラーメッセージの内容を書いてみましょう。
     エラーメッセージにはエラー原因が詳しく書かれていることが多く、
     問題の解決につながる回答が得られるかもしれません。


    ■ベストアンサーについて

    ご質問の締め切りに際して、運営チームにて
    ベストアンサーを選んでおります。

     ※ベストアンサーの回答者様には通常と同様のポイントが
      付与されています。


    --ネットオウル運営チーム--

  • 投稿者:ネットオウル運営 投稿時間:2022/05/26 13:41